Smoker One Piece - Smoker is one of the marines who is very eager to chase after Luffy, even going so far as to pursue him into the New World. Here are 7 facts about Smoker in One Piece:

Witnessed Gol D. Roger's Execution


During Gol D. Roger's execution, many people were present to witness it, including Smoker. He was amazed by Roger's ability to smile despite knowing he would die.

Encountered Monkey D. Dragon


As we know, Smoker has made several attempts to capture Luffy. One person who helped Luffy when he was captured by Smoker was Monkey D. Dragon, Luffy's father and the most wanted man in the world.

Rescued by Luffy


Smoker was once imprisoned in the same cell as Luffy and his crew when they were captured by Crocodile. When the prison was destroyed, Zoro saved Smoker. Due to Smoker being a Devil Fruit user, he would have drowned and died without Zoro's assistance. Zoro mentioned that he was merely following his captain's orders.

Falsely Accused of Defeating Crocodile


Luffy was the one who defeated Crocodile, but to cover up this fact, the World Government manipulated the news, claiming that Smoker had defeated him. This greatly angered Smoker, and he even insulted those spreading the false news.

Collaboration with Pirates


Despite being a Marine officer who doesn't hesitate to capture pirates, Smoker once collaborated with the pirate Trafalgar Law to defeat Vergo.

Haki Usage


When facing Vergo, Smoker was seen using Busoshoku Haki to confront him. Vergo himself had a considerable level of Busoshoku Haki. This was unique as Smoker had not been previously shown using Haki
